Credentials & Experience: I am an Associate Licensed Counselor and a Marriage & Family Intern licensed in the state of Alabama. I practice under the supervision of a Licensed Professional Counselor-Supervisor (LPC-S) and a Licensed Marriage and Family Therapist (LMFT) who is also a Certified Group Therapist (CGT).
"I offer a blended therapeutic approach, combining client-centered techniques with evidence-based therapies tailored to your unique needs. My specialized training includes Lifespan Integration, a gentle method that helps resolve past trauma and foster a stronger sense of self by working with your body's natural healing processes. I also use Gottman Therapy, a research-backed approach for couples that provides practical tools to strengthen communication, rebuild trust, and deepen emotional connection. For couples preparing for marriage, I offer pre-marital counseling through Prepare/Enrich, a proven program that helps you and your partner explore your strengths, identify growth areas, and build a solid foundation for your future together."

Insurance & Policies
I keep therapy affordable and accessible by working on a private pay basis. While I'm not in-network with insurance plans and don't offer direct insurance billing, I can bill through supervisory billing and provide a superbill that you can submit to your insurance company for out-of-network reimbursement.
